Blog

API Security: 10 Best Practices for REST API Security [Updated 2024]

10 Best Practices for REST API Security in Singapore REST (Representational State Transfer) is a popular architectural style for developing web-based APIs.  Most current web framework-based apps will include one or more REST APIs.  A straightforward and adaptable method of constructing a web API is REST.  In addition, it is more of a collection of

Best Information Security Services in Singapore [Updated 2024]

Introduction It is one of the foremost needs to secure your IT infrastructures with the best information security services by making a world-class cyber security strategy. Furnishing information security plays a pivotal role in protecting your confidential organizational datasets against severe cyber attacks and cyber threats.  In addition, providing your business with well-established information security

Cyber Security Solutions for Small Businesses in Singapore [2024]

Cyber Security Solutions for Small Businesses in Singapore Every individual or organization that is doing business in this new technology-filled world is thinking positively about linking with their users in such a way that they interact with them regularly with the help of some proficient digital marketing tactics.  In this regard, there is a heavy

Cyber Security Services for Individuals in Singapore [2024]

Cyber Security Services for Individuals in Singapore How do I protect myself from cyberattacks? There are a lot of Cyber Security Services for Individuals in Singapore available in the IT Sector. However, do you know why they need such technology and facilities? The Best VAPT Services provider in Singapore, Craw Security, will tell you how

Enquire Now

Cyber Security services
Open chat
Hello
Greetings From Craw Cyber Security !!
Can we help you?

Fatal error: Uncaught TypeError: preg_match() expects parameter 2 to be string, null given in /home/crawsg/domains/craw.sg/public_html/wp-content/plugins/WP-Rocket-v3.10/inc/Engine/Optimization/DelayJS/HTML.php:221 Stack trace: #0 /home/crawsg/domains/craw.sg/public_html/wp-content/plugins/WP-Rocket-v3.10/inc/Engine/Optimization/DelayJS/HTML.php(221): preg_match() #1 /home/crawsg/domains/craw.sg/public_html/wp-content/plugins/WP-Rocket-v3.10/inc/Engine/Optimization/DelayJS/Subscriber.php(114): WP_Rocket\Engine\Optimization\DelayJS\HTML->move_meta_charset_to_head() #2 /home/crawsg/domains/craw.sg/public_html/wp-includes/class-wp-hook.php(324): WP_Rocket\Engine\Optimization\DelayJS\Subscriber->add_delay_js_script() #3 /home/crawsg/domains/craw.sg/public_html/wp-includes/plugin.php(205): WP_Hook->apply_filters() #4 /home/crawsg/domains/craw.sg/public_html/wp-content/plugins/WP-Rocket-v3.10/inc/classes/Buffer/class-optimization.php(104): apply_filters() #5 [internal function]: WP_Rocket\Buffer\Optimization->maybe_process_buff in /home/crawsg/domains/craw.sg/public_html/wp-content/plugins/WP-Rocket-v3.10/inc/Engine/Optimization/DelayJS/HTML.php on line 221